WebConwy Castle and Walls. Part of one of Wales' UNESCO World Heritage Sites, climb to the top of one of Conwy Castle's eight towers to get a stunning view over Conwy and the surrounding area. Investigate the inner and outer wards with their many rooms and explore the castle walls with their 21 towers that completely enclose Conwy town. Conwy Castle. The trail starts in town near the railway station and, after exploring the Conwy riverbank and … WebThis walk rises to the top of the mountain, following a broad grassy way along its spine, before dropping to the Sychnant Pass (Bwlch Sychnant) and returning to Conwy through farmland pastures. The top of Conwy mountain is occupied by the remnants of over fifty Neolithic hut circles and by Castell Caer Seion, an Iron Age stone-walled hill fort.
